Alternative Impressions showcases the alternative photographic process of Kitty Hubbard’s work. \n \nKitty Hubbard: Alternative Impressions\nAlternative Impressions include one-of-a-kind photographic works using alternative processes. Hubbard’s work employs historic analog image-making techniques including cyanotypes and lumen printing that is powered by the sun\, and the moon for exposure. Both analog and digital printing techniques are integrated to migrate to mediums like hand coated fine art papers and fabric. Alternative Impressions includes subject matter like plant materials and personal objects. These become an integral part of the creative process; often interacting chemically with the surfaces they are printed on. \n \nAbout Kitty Hubbard\nKitty Hubbard is an intermedia artist and Associate Professor of Photography in the Department of Art at SUNY Brockport. She completed her BA in Photography at Guilford College in Greensboro\, NC where she studied photography with Merry Moor Winnett and was the first woman to graduate with a Photography concentration in Art at the College in 1987. Hubbard completed her MFA at Visual Studies Workshop in Rochester\, New York in 1998. Bank of America “Museums on Us” Weekend\nWhat is Museums on Us? \nDesigned to provide a benefit to Bank of America and Merrill Lynch customers and increase access to the arts across the United States\, Museums on Us offers FREE general admission to more than 150 museums in some 90 cities the first full weekend of every month! The program brings new audiences and increased attention to participating organizations\, which range from some of the nation’s most celebrated museums to regional gems and include art\, science and history museums\, as well as other cultural institutions. \nProgram Information:\nEach Bank of America or Merrill Lynch cardholder is allowed one free general admission to participating institutions on any eligible MOU day. \n• Admission is non-transferable and for the cardholder only.\n• Any valid Bank of America or Merrill Lynch credit or debit card is acceptable. Photo ID is required along with the card.\n• Offer does not include free admission to special exhibitions and ticketed shows.\n• Free admission does not guarantee reservations.\n• The program applies only to the first full weekend (consecutive Saturday and Sunday) of every month.\n• Bank of America and Merrill Lynch associates are also eligible for free general admission on MOU weekends.
